Hang Seng Rises 0.9% at Finish
Wednesday, December 17, 2025       15:48 WIB

The Hang Seng climbed 233 points, or 0.9%, to close at 25,469 on Wednesday, snapping two straight sessions of sharp falls as gains spread across all sectors.
The index rebounded from a near four-week low, supported by bargain hunting after recent losses.
Mainland markets also recovered, helped by renewed strength in tech shares, which lifted sentiment across the region.
Meantime, analysts at Goldman Sachs said Chinese equities could rise about 30% by the end of 2027, citing continued pro-market policies, improving corporate earnings, and sustained capital inflows.
The Hang Seng Tech Index outperformed, rising 1.0%, after another eye-catching debut by chipmaker MetaX Integrated Circuits Shanghai, whose shares surged about 755% after raising around USD 585.8 million in its initial public offering.
Still, gains were capped by caution ahead of Hong Kong's November inflation data due next week.
Pop Mart Intl. jumped 3.7%, and Trip.com added 2.6%, while SMIC and Meituan rose 2.4%, each.
